☐ Step 7 — EXIF scrub verification. Before the Larkmoor key ceremony photos are archived, run the Pixelwane scrubber on every image and confirm GPS, device serial, and timestamp tags are removed. Spot-check three files manually. Once verification passes, record the recovery passphrase exactly as shown below.

unlock words, yawig-kagef: gordor-holvan-ulaael-pramir-ulaiel-tamdor

Ticket BRM-4412 — Descriptor leak in Coldpike ingest daemon. Under sustained load, open FDs climb until the ulimit trips. Traced to the retry path in the archive fetcher: sockets aren't closed on timeout. Patch closes them in a finally block. For audit purposes, the fixed build's trace token follows.

trace token, taguf-yajop: htk6_3fef6e

## Tuning

Vaultglass (our audit-log viewer) is read-only by design, so the tuning story is mostly about how hard it leans on the log store. The retention window, page size, and query timeout all have security implications — a too-generous window means reviewers can pull more history than policy intends, and a too-long timeout invites expensive fishing queries. We'd like a second set of eyes on the current values, which are shown below.

tuning table, kajog-kawef:
PRIORITIES = {
    "kelox": 870,
    "kasix": 89,
    "eliax": 988,
}